@MacyySuee3 жыл бұрын
It is 100% legitimate, I was concerned how reputable it was too but I spoke with several attorneys from different parts of California who all said it’s an amazing school and from my experience so far I absolutely agree! They are only recently accredited so hopefully in the near future that means it will be recognized for student loan purposes although their payment plan is great too!

16,000 for a JD is pretty great. I can use it to take the Bar in my state after a set time.
@gemalopez68853 жыл бұрын
@@That_Metal_Dude If you decided to apply to this school make sure you want to practice Law in California. This school is accredited only in California. It's not a t-14 school (ABA approved).
